BACKGROUND AND OBJECTIVESUrinary tract infection (UTI) is one of the most common bacterial infections. The investigations estimated that ۸۰% of UTI are caused by “Escherichia coli” bacteria. The global decrease in the effectiveness of antibiotics in the treatment of bacterial infections has created a new interest in the use of bacteriophages in the treatment of infections. The purpose of this research was to isolate and identify bacteriophage effective on E. coli straind isolated from UTI.MATERIALS AND METHODSE. coli strains isolated from urine specimens of patients with UTI, their antibiotic susceptibility was obtained from the clinical microbiology laboratory at the Mofid hospital. They were confirmed as UPEC with the help of biochemical and PCR methods. in this study, the phage was isolated from Mofid hospital sewage, and spot test were used for validation of phage presence. Then the phage was purified and enriched using the double layer agar techniques. To determine the morphology of the isolated phage the Transmission Electron Microscopy (TEM) was used. The effect of environmental factors on the phage such as thermal stability, pH effect and stability in the presence of chloroform and different concentrations of NaCl was determined.RESULTS AND DISCUSSIONIsolating bacteriophage had the ability to create suitable plaques and lyse bacteria. Based on the TEM results, the isolated phage had a large polyhedral head and a short retractable tail, belonging to the Myoviridae family. The isolated phage had the best activity at ۳۷°C. The phage has a suitable lytic activity at pH ۷, inactivation phage was observed in ۷۰°C and PH ۱۴. Phage lytic activity increased with increasing NaCl concentration (۵%-۱۰%-۱۵%). The phage was resistant to chloroform.CONCLUSIONThe isolated bacteriophage had a specific lytic activity against E. coli caused UTI. This phage can be used in phage therapy as an alternative treatment for people with UTIs which are resistant to antibiotics.
